Removal of cerium ions from aqueous solution by hydrous ferric oxide – A radiotracer study

Som Shankar Dubey; Battula Sreenivasa Rao

Radiotracer technique has been used to study the removal behavior of Ce (III) ions from aqueous solutions by synthesized and well characterized hydrous ferric oxide (HFO). Adsorptive concentration (10(-4)-10(-8) mol dm(-3)), pH (ca 4.0-10.0) and temperature (303-333 K) were examined for assessing optimal conditions for removal of these ions. The uptake of Ce (III) ions, which fitted well for Freundlich and D-R isotherms, increased with increase in the temperature and no significant desorption took place in the studied temperature range. The presence of some anions/cations affected the uptake of metal ion markedly. Irradiation of hydrous ferric oxide and tungsten oxide by using a 11.1×10(9) Bq (Ra-Be) neutron source having a neutron flux of 3.9×10(6) cm(-2) s(-1) with associated γ-dose rate of 1.72 Gy/h did not influence the extent of adsorption of Ce (III) significantly.

Validation of Quetiapine Fumarate in Pharmaceutical Dosage by Reverse-Phase HPLC with Internal Standard Method

Kiran B. Venkata; Sreenivas Rao Battula; Som Shankar Dubey

A rapid, specific, and accurate isocratic HPLC method was developed and validated for the assay of quetiapine fumarate in pharmaceutical dosage forms. The assay involved an isocratic-elution of quetiapine fumarate in Grace C18 column using mobile-phase composition of 0.1% ortho phosphoric acid with triethyl amine as modifier buffer and acetonitrile in the ratio of 50 : 50 (v/v).The wavelength of detection is 294 nm. The method showed good linearity in the range of 2.0–50.2 × 10−3 g/Lt. The runtime of the method is 5 mins. The developed method was applied to directly and easily analyse of the pharmaceutical tablet preparations. The percentage recoveries were near 100% for given methods. The method was completely validated and proven to be rugged. The excipients did not interfere in the analysis. The results showed that this method can be used for rapid determination of quetiapine fumarate in pharmaceutical tablet with precision, accuracy, and specificity.

Efficient Removal of Ce(III) and Eu(III) Ions from Aqueous Solutions by Local Clay -A Radiotracer Study

Som Shankar Dubey; Battula Sreenivasa Rao; B. S. A. Andrews; B. Venkata Kiran

Radiotracer technique has been used to study the removal behavior of Ce(III) and Eu(III) ions from aqueous solutions by local clay. Adsorptive concentration (10-4–10-6 mol dm-3), pH (ca 2.0-9.0) and temperature (303-333 K) were examined for assessing optimal conditions for removal of these ions. The adsorption phenomenon was highly dependent on the amount of the adsorbent concentrations. The uptake of ions, which fitted well for Freundlich isotherm, increased with increase in the temperature and no significant desorption took place in the studied temperature range. The energy of adsorption process for the both cations indicates that the adsorption phenomenon is of chemisorption type. The rate kinetics of the adsorption followed the first order rate kinetics.
